>Howdy, I finally had a moment to get back on this. I have dumped the
>sessiondb and now have a new one, I have restarted MV and rebuilt the
>catalog. My search engine is still behaving badly. I swtiched back to text
>based searches and that too is currupt. I have put an out of order not on the
>search page as the shop is still fine otherwise, online encrypted orders as
>long as they dont touch the search engine.
>
>Do you think its somewhere in the products database? Or should I rewrite
>the search form page. The result page works for everything but the search so
>I dont think it is that....
Yup, see below.

> > > > That is the result of a corrupted products.asc or
> > > > products.gdbm. I'm quite good at doing that. Stop your minivend
> > > > server, move products.gdbm to a backup and restart the server. If
> > > > that doesn't fix it, examine your products.asc for mistakes. Oh, not
> > > > to mention, pitch all your page/search caches to be safe.
